Full Job Description

Working in our busy and friendly Trading department, you will be responsible for the sourcing of new products and treatments to offer our valued customers, ensuring stock availability, building, and managing supplier relationships and supporting our sales channels.

Applicants should be enthusiastic, confident, communicative, and well organised. This is a great opportunity to work in a dynamic customer focused company that focuses on the development of its people.

Overall purpose

To ensure sufficient stock availability to achieve overall sales and margin targets.

To action sales channel requests promptly and effectively.

Key responsibilities

Achieve individual, team and company Key Performance Indicators (KPI's).

Negotiate supplier retro's, promotional support, and rate card funding.

Ensure product details are updated on internal systems to include correct weights and dimensions.

Liaise with internal customers promptly.

Process special purchase orders.

Update all promotions and NPD in line with agreed deadlines.

Keep the Trading Manager fully informed of any current/impending problems.

In the absence of any Trading team member, cover their priority tasks.

Undertake any other duties, within reason, as defined by the Trading Manager and Head of Trading and Digital Marketing

Maintain 'good housekeeping' standards, ensuring tidiness, safety and good working practices are adhered to.

Stock

Monitor slow moving stock and propose actions to remedy to Trading Manager.

Regularly review minimum/maximum re-order levels and forecast stock where required.

Raise and place replenishment orders with approved suppliers, ensuring continuity of stock levels within minimum/maximum levels.
